Kristaps Porzingis and Luka Doncic were teammates for two and a half years before the Latvian forward was traded to the Wizards in February of last year.

When the Mavericks first acquired Porzingis, the hopes were that he and Doncic would form a star duo. However, the two players never reached that level of success together.

“I thought so too, for sure,” Porzingis said while agreeing that his fit with Doncic wasn’t a perfect one, via Michael Mulford of Sports Illustrated. “Yeah, I don’t know. We never played up to that level. And a lot of it’s on me.”

This past season Porzingis averaged 23.2 points, 8.4 rebounds and 2.7 assists in 32.6 minutes per game.
